Literature

Structural and mechanistic insights into a Bacteroides vulgatus retaining N-acetyl-beta-galactosaminidase that uses neighbouring group participation.

Roth, C.Petricevic, M.John, A.Goddard-Borger, E.D.Davies, G.J.Williams, S.J.

(2016) Chem Commun (Camb) 52: 11096-11099

  • DOI: https://doi.org/10.1039/c6cc04649e
  • Primary Citation of Related Structures:  
    5L7R, 5L7V

  • PubMed Abstract: 

    Bacteroides vulgatus is a member of the human microbiota whose abundance is increased in patients with Crohn's disease. We show that a B. vulgatus glycoside hydrolase from the carbohydrate active enzyme family GH123, BvGH123, is an N-acetyl-β-galactosaminidase that acts with retention of stereochemistry, and, through a 3-D structure in complex with Gal-thiazoline, provide evidence in support of a neighbouring group participation mechanism.
